The Strategic Value of (9-phenylcarbazol-2-yl)boronic Acid
(9-phenylcarbazol-2-yl)boronic acid (CAS: 1001911-63-2) is a crucial building block in the synthesis of many organic semiconductors used in OLED devices. Its carbazole structure imparts excellent charge transport and thermal properties, while the boronic acid group facilitates its integration into complex molecular architectures via cross-coupling reactions. The increasing demand for higher efficiency and longer lifespan in displays means that intermediates like this are becoming increasingly important for companies developing new OLED emitters, hosts, and transport layers.

Key Considerations for Cost-Effective Purchasing
To ensure a cost-effective procurement strategy for (9-phenylcarbazol-2-yl)boronic acid, consider the following:
- Bulk Purchasing: Order larger quantities if your project timeline and consumption rates allow, as this typically leads to lower per-kilogram pricing.
- Long-Term Contracts: Negotiate longer-term supply agreements with manufacturers to secure stable pricing and ensure consistent availability.
- Supplier Vetting: Thoroughly vet potential suppliers. Look for companies with a proven track record in supplying to the OLED industry, clear quality assurance processes, and positive customer reviews.
- Total Cost of Ownership: Beyond the unit price, consider shipping costs, import duties, lead times, and the potential cost of rejected batches due to poor quality. A slightly higher initial price for a reliably pure product can often be more cost-effective in the long run.
